# SC Freiburg Defeats Hertha BSC, Grifo’s Goal Lifts Team to New Heights

In a thrilling encounter at the Schwarzwald Stadion, SC Freiburg delivered a statement victory over Hertha BSC, emerging 2-1 winners in a match that had everything. The game, which was crucial for both sides, saw Freiburg rise to fifth in the Bundesliga standings, while Hertha BSC dropped to ninth.

The match started at a steady pace, with Freiburg looking to exploit Hertha’s defensive vulnerabilities. It was Grifo, the influential midfielder, who broke the deadlock in the 18th minute with a clinical finish. The goal, a thing of beauty, saw Grifo exploit a defensive error and slot the ball into the bottom corner, sending the home crowd into delirium.

Hertha, despite their defensive struggles, responded well and almost leveled the score in the 35th minute when Adrian Ramos fired a powerful shot from outside the box. However, Freiburg’s defense held firm, and the visitors struggled to create clear chances. The half ended with Freiburg leading 1-0.

The second half saw Freiburg dominate possession and control, with Grifo once again playing a pivotal role. In the 63rd minute, Grifo delivered a pinpoint cross into the box, and Kevin Schade capitalized on a defensive slip to head the ball into the net. This goal, coupled with Grifo’s earlier strike, ensured Freiburg’s victory and sent the fans into raptures.

Despite a late rally from Hertha, which included a saved penalty by Freiburg’s goalkeeper, the hosts held on for a well-deserved win. The result not only lifted Freiburg’s spirits but also put them firmly in the hunt for a top-half finish in the Bundesliga.

Grifo, who has been instrumental in Freiburg’s recent form, was praised for his all-around performance and leadership on the pitch. His goal and assist highlighted his importance to the team, and he became the hero once again for the Black Forest side.

Looking ahead, Freiburg will aim to build on this victory as they prepare for their next clash against RB Leipzig. With a win under their belt, confidence is high, and the team is now seen as a potential threat at the higher end of the table.

For Hertha BSC, the defeat marks another shaky period in their season. The Berliners must regroup quickly and address their defensive issues if they are to turn things around and climb the standings.
